Small Space, Big Style: Bathroom Remodel Ideas Under $5,000
Tired of a cramped bathroom that feels more like a closet? You don't need to break the bank to transform your small area into a stylish oasis. With a little creativity and these budget-friendly ideas, you can create a bathroom that feels both spacious and chic, all for under $5,000!
First, focus on maximizing light. Swap out old, dull fixtures with modern, energy-efficient lights to instantly brighten the space. Consider adding a modern mirror to reflect light and create an illusion of vastness.
Next, choose a combination that makes your bathroom feel larger. Light, neutral tones like white, cream, or soft gray will help the space appear more open.
You can also add pops of shade with accessories and fabrics.
Don't forget about the floor! Surfaces in a light color or pattern can make a big variation.
And finally, think about storage solutions. Adding shelving, floating cabinets, or even a attractive over-the-toilet unit will help keep your bathroom clutter-free and organized.

DIY Bathroom Remodel Projects That Won't Cost a Fortune
Dreaming of a sparkling bathroom but dreading the hefty price tag? Have no not! With a little creativity and elbow grease, you can transform your tired space into a haven without breaking the bank.
Start by tackling simple updates. A fresh coat of paint can work wonders, instantly brightening up the area. Swap out outdated hardware like faucets and towel bars for trendy alternatives. And don't forget the power of new shower curtains and mats to add a pop of personality.
For a more ambitious remodel, consider replacing your vanity or sink. You can often find great deals on used fixtures at vintage stores. Get creative and reuse old furniture into unique bathroom elements.
Remember, a successful DIY project is all about careful planning and implementation. Take your time, do your research, and enjoy the process of creating your dream bathroom!
